Decree of Justice (Scourge)

Rarity : R
Casting Cost : XX2
Card Type : Sorcery
Card Text : Put X 4/4 white Angel creature tokens with flying into play.
Artist : Adam Rex

Put X 4/4 white Angel creature tokens with flying into play. Cycling 2* When you cycle Decree of Justice, you may pay X. If you do, put X 1/1 white Soldier creature tokens into play.

***** White controls best kill card, period. It can get you an uncounterable army of 1/1s and draw a card at instant speed. giant 4/4 flyers are tough to beat when you've wiped the board a turn earlier with a wrath of god, akroma's vengeance, etc. Truly a must have for every control/mana accel. deck with white in it
